Abstract Background Large neuroendocrine lung cancer was less than adenocarcinoma or squamous cell carcinoma of lung. EZH2 expression was high in small cell lung cancer with component of neuroendocrine. There was no study of EZH2 in large neuroendocrine lung cancer. We planned to identify the expression of EZH2 and EMT markers and the clinical outcome in large neuroendocrine lung cancer. Methods and Patient There were 25 resectable large neuroendocrine lung cancer patients in our hospital before 2014. Twenty-two patients' tissue was done for EZH2 and EMT markers. The EZH2-GSK3 and EMT signaling were performed in H1299 and H460 cancer cell lines. EZH2 inhibitor, Akt inhibitor and protease inhibitor was used to validate the cell signaling from EZH2 to EMT markers. Results There were 10 patients had high EZH2 and snail and 10 patients had low EZH2 and snail. The correlation between EZH2 and snail was very high. Snail expression showed high prevalence of lymph node metastasis but no EZH2. The overall survival and progression free survival showed no definite in EZH2 and other insomnia. The recurrence was also not significant difference. The cellular study showed the same result. Conclusion Over expression of snail showed high correlation with EZH2 and was a predictable marker. Citation Format: Yueh-Fu Fang, Min-Chia Lee. High expression of snail is associated with EZH2 expression and lymph node metastasis in large neuroendocrine lung cancer [abstract]. In: Proceedings of the American Association for Cancer Research Annual Meeting 2018; 2018 Apr 14-18; Chicago, IL. Philadelphia (PA): AACR; Cancer Res 2018;78(13 Suppl):Abstract nr 4617.
